Coca-Cola for sale?

Saw this on the news this morning. The nerve of some people. What gets me is they actually thought they would get away with this.


ATLANTA - Coca-Cola and Pepsi are usually bitter enemies, but when PepsiCo Inc. got a letter offering to sell Coke trade secrets, it went straight to its corporate rival.
Six weeks later, three people face federal charges of stealing confidential information, including a sample of a new drink, from The Coca-Cola Co. and trying to sell it to PepsiCo Inc.
“Competition can sometimes be fierce, but also must be fair and legal,” Pepsi spokesman Dave DeCecco said. “We’re pleased the authorities and the FBI have identified the people responsible for this.”

Re: Coca-Cola for sale?

I used to work for Coca-Cola. The competition between them & Pepsi is unbelievable! Two huge cut-throat companies who would stop at nothing... I saw a lot! Management was told/taught numerous ways to undermind the competition. I'm sure this is true with all large businesses in corporate America. We were not allowed to purchase ANY competitors products even when we were "off the clock" nor were we supposed to eat at restaurants that did not serve "our" products. You're given a list to keep with you at your first orientation. The list of "off limits" was very long & got very deep....

Re: Coca-Cola for sale?

Quote:
Now that's a pretty TALL order to say you can't do something on "your own time"! Gin, Did you ever "break" that rule?? I guess it's like the health care company in the Midwest telling their associates they couldn't smoke in their free time. Seems to me it would be very hard to "police" the issue.
As you sign their policy when you are hired into management, you really feel that it's not optional. Hardest thing for me was NOT eating at Taco Bell (owned by PepsiCo) and NOT drinking Dr. Pepper. HOWEVER, we could go to Montgomery, Opelika or Scottsboro to attend the quarterly Area meetings & drink Dr. Pepper because Coke had the distribution in their area but Tuscaloosa & Dothan does not. I won't say I NEVER "broke their rule" but if I did (I literally crave diet Dr. Pepper), I was looking over my shoulder first.... We had a guy in maintenance get into serious trouble for being seen in a Coke van & in a Coke uniform in the drive-thru at KFC. One of the Sales Supervisors even took his pic with a digital camera & took it back to the Sales Center to report him. I'm telling you, the soft drink industry is VERY cut-throat. I had to work at our tent on the Quad at any home UA football games. We were instructed to offer anyone walking by drinking a competitors product one of ours & throw their's away.
